Introducing our gas mass flowmeter, specifically engineered for measuring hydrogen and air flow with precision and efficiency.
Our explosion-proof 4-20mA hydrogen gas mass flow meter is meticulously crafted for optimal performance in monitoring and controlling small pipe flows. This sophisticated series is capable of measuring gas flow in pipes with diameters as minute as 3 mm,yet can adeptly handle diameters up to 19 mm. Featuring an advanced self-flow conditioning MEMS sensor package, these meters exhibit minimal pressure loss when compared to traditional by-pass thermal mass flow meters, making them ideal for this particular application range. They boast an impressive accuracy of ±(1.5+0.2FS)% or better, customizable based on specific requirements. Designed to operate seamlessly in environments with temperatures ranging from -20 to 60°C and pressures reaching up to 1.5 MPa, these meters find applications in diverse fields, including semiconductor gas process monitoring and control, as well as hospital oxygen gas monitoring.
